When it comes to workshop flooring, two materials often come to mind: traditional concrete and industrial metal flooring. Each has its own set of advantages and considerations, so how do you decide which is best for your workspace? Let’s dive into the key differences between metal flooring and concrete flooring to help you make an informed choice for your workshop.
1. Durability and Longevity
One of the most important factors when choosing flooring for a workshop is how well it can stand up to wear and tear.
-Concrete Flooring: Concrete is a durable material, but it’s not immune to damage. Over time, cracks can develop due to heavy machinery or impact. The surface may also wear down, leading to rough spots that can pose safety hazards. Concrete is also prone to staining from oil or chemical spills, which may affect both the aesthetics and functionality of your workshop.
-Metal Flooring: Metal flooring, particularly steel flooring, is known for its exceptional strength and resistance to impact. It’s less likely to crack or deteriorate over time, making it a more long-lasting option for heavy-duty environments. Metal floors can handle high levels of stress, from machinery to constant foot traffic, without compromising their integrity.
2. Safety Features
Safety should always be a priority in a workshop, especially when dealing with tools, machinery, and materials that can cause injuries.
-Concrete Flooring: Concrete can become slippery when wet, increasing the risk of slips and falls. Without the proper treatment, it can be dangerous, especially in high-traffic areas. However, with added coatings or anti-slip treatments, the safety of concrete can be improved.
-Metal Flooring: Steel floors often come with anti-slip surfaces that are specifically designed to prevent accidents. With textured patterns, perforations, or raised designs, metal flooring offers superior traction, making it a safer option for high-risk environments. This is especially important in areas where oils, liquids, or debris are likely to spill.
3. Maintenance Requirements
Maintaining flooring can be costly and time-consuming, especially in a workshop setting where heavy use is the norm.
-Concrete Flooring: Concrete requires periodic maintenance to keep it in top condition. Cracks must be repaired to prevent further damage, and stains or spills should be cleaned up quickly to avoid long-term marks. Sealing the floor is also necessary to protect it from moisture and chemicals.
-Metal Flooring: Metal floors are relatively low maintenance. They’re resistant to most stains and spills, and they don’t require the constant sealing and patching that concrete does. Occasional cleaning with water and mild detergent is typically enough to keep the floor in good condition. Additionally, many metal floors are rust-resistant, ensuring longevity even in harsh conditions.
4. Installation Time and Cost
Both installation time and cost are crucial factors for any workshop owner looking to upgrade their flooring.
-Concrete Flooring: Installing concrete floors can be time-consuming and labor-intensive, especially if new concrete needs to be poured or existing floors require major repairs. The curing process alone can take several days, delaying the project further. In terms of cost, concrete tends to be a more affordable initial option, but long-term maintenance costs can add up.
-Metal Flooring: Installing metal flooring is generally quicker than pouring concrete. Steel tiles or panels can be laid down with relative ease, reducing downtime in your workshop. While metal flooring may have a higher upfront cost compared to concrete, its durability and lower maintenance requirements often make it a more cost-effective option over time.
Both metal and concrete flooring have their advantages, but the best option depends on the specific needs of your workshop. If you’re looking for a durable, low-maintenance, and slip-resistant solution, industrial steel flooring is likely the better choice. It’s especially suitable for high-traffic areas with heavy machinery and potential spills.
On the other hand, if cost is a primary concern and you’re working in a less demanding environment, concrete flooring could be the more budget-friendly option. However, be prepared for the ongoing maintenance that comes with it.
Ultimately, your decision will hinge on factors like budget, safety concerns, and the level of wear and tear your floor will face. By evaluating these considerations carefully, you can choose the flooring that will best serve your workshop for years to come.
